Summary:
Charts are presented for determining the performance of airplanes having variable-pitch propellers, the pitch of which is assumed to be adjusted to maintain constant speed for all rates of flight.
The charts are based on the general performance equations developed by Oswald, and are used in a similar manner.
Examples applying the charts to airplanes having both supercharged and unsupercharged engines are included.
